Consider the ideas of chivalry and courtly love. how did they influence the arts during the late middle ages? do you think dante
prohojiy [21]
The ideas of chivalry and courtly love are widely evident in the Middle Ages among the knights. It is modeled after the Arthurian legend in England that combines Christian virtues with military values. Chivalry is the code of conduct that knights upheld. Courtly love, on the other hand, is a romantic devotion to someone who is virtually unattainable. 
Dante is definitely influenced by these two ideas in writing his Divine Comedy.
It is the predominant culture after all. Although not widely used throughout the poem, it is very evident in Dante's love for the unattainable Beatrice. It is moving him enormously throughout the poem. Poets during the medieval ages were able to elevate courtly love into something philosophical and more profound meaning for love.

What efforts needed to be done on the home front during world war 1?
Lilit [14]

Answer:

The United States homefront during World War I saw a systematic mobilization of the country's entire population and economy to produce the soldiers, food supplies, ammunitions and money necessary to win the war.
